As a Nurse Home Visitor, you will work closely with community family partnership workers to provide home visiting and education services to women pregnant with an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ander baby and their families. This is an opportunity to make a positive impact on the lives of these families and contribute to the well-being of Indigenous communities.
Key aspects of this role include fostering culturally safe relationships, promoting high-level engagement, and ensuring successful program outcomes. To achieve this, you will need to demonstrate understanding of nursing processes, build therapeutic relationships, and utilise sound problem-solving techniques.
The ideal candidate for this position will be a registered nurse or midwife with a minimum of 2 years' clinical experience, preferably in Maternal and Child Health. Ongoing training and professional development opportunities will be provided to help you develop your skills and knowledge further.
Required Skills and Qualifications- Demonstrate understanding of nursing processes and clinical expertise
- Build therapeutic relationships and maintain therapeutic boundaries
- Utilise sound problem-solving techniques and negotiation skills in accordance with motivational and interviewing and behaviour change theory
